Hint: Rhizobium is responsible for nitrogen fixation. Rhizobium belongs to gram-negative bacteria and comes under the family Rhizobiaceae. The order of Rhizobium is categorized as Rhizobiales. Rhizobium is predominantly found in the leguminous region of the plants.
Complete answer:
• Rhizobium is usually involved in a symbiotic relationship with root and legume region of the plants
• The function of Rhizobium is nitrogen fixation by converting the nitrogen dioxide to ammonia (${{N}_{2}}\to N{{H}_{3}}$)${{N}_{2}}\to N{{H}_{3}}$
• Fertility of the agricultural field is increased by nitrogen fixation
• Nitrogen fixation helps from the drought, stress, fertilizers and pesticides
• The initial process of the nitrogen cycle is Nitrogen fixation which converts the nitrogen to ammonia, nitrites and nitrates
• The enzyme involved in the conversion of dinitrogen to ammonia are Nitrogenase
• Nitrogenase activity or the effect of nitrogenase can be measured by Acetylene reduction assay
• By the nitrogen fixation, nitrogen is made easily available for all the plants thereby helps for plant growth and development
• Rhizobium creates a nodule in the place where it infects, which is required for the nitrogen fixation (${{N}_{2}}\to N{{H}_{3}}$)
• During the death of legume, there will be a breakdown of nodules
• Nitrogen fixation is necessary because most of the plants cannot use or absorb the atmospheric nitrogen even though it is abundant in nature. Therefore, plants form the symbiotic relationship with soil bacteria in converting nitrogen to ammonia
• Rhizobium can be either Pathogenic or non-pathogenic
• Rhizobium also act as a biofertilizer
• Rhizobium enhances the nutrient content of the plants, helps to improve the growth and development of the plants
• Based on the association of rhizobium with the plants, it can be classified
• The classification of Rhizobium includes Rhizobium leguminosarum, Rhizobium alamii, Rhizobium lantis, Rhizobium japonicum, Rhizobium trioli, Rhizobium phaseoli, Rhizobium smilacinae
Note: Rhizobium is essential for nitrogen -fixation. Rhizobium is essential for plant growth and development. The classification of Rhizobium includes Rhizobium leguminosarum, Rhizobium alamii, Rhizobium lantis, Rhizobium japonicum, Rhizobium trioli, Rhizobium phaseoli, Rhizobium smilacinae.
